What colors go well with #6B6A2E?
The complementary color is HSL(239, 40%, 30%). For a triadic harmony, use hues 59°, 179°, and 299°. For analogous combinations, try hues 29° and 89°. See the Color Harmony section above for complete palettes with previews.
